dual exhaust to single

Hi,
I got dual 3" mufflers on right now and they are a little too loud.
The piping also seems to big for my n/a.
Would using just one muffler make it quieter?
I was thinking of just replacing the Y-pipe with a single pipe. Is there anyone selling those or do I have to custom make it?

Single is louder than dual, think about it 1 muffler or 2, which will be louder?

3" is definately too big for an n/a, I think 2.5" is the biggest an n/a needs.

*EDIT*
Yes people sell singles. Corksport and FC3S.org make single catbacks.
